DoD Critical Infrastructure Security Information DCRIT
A CUI category in the Defense grouping of NARA's registry, CUI Basic, marked CUI.
For a defense contractor
Foxx Cyber's note, not NARA's
Marked DCRIT. Vulnerability and protective-measure information about defence installations and infrastructure.
NARA's description
CUI Registry · DoD Critical Infrastructure Security InformationInformation that, if disclosed, would reveal vulnerabilities in the DoD critical infrastructure and, if exploited, would likely result in the significant disruption, destruction, or damage of or to DoD operations, property, or facilities, including information regarding the securing and safeguarding of explosives, hazardous chemicals, or pipelines, related to critical infrastructure or protected systems owned or operated on behalf of the DoD, including vulnerability assessments prepared by or on behalf of the DoD, explosives safety information (including storage and handling), and other site-specific information on or relating to installation security.

A banner reads CUI for Basic categories and CUI//SP-DCRIT for Specified ones, followed by any limited dissemination control such as NOFORN. How the marking rule works, verbatim from 32 CFR 2002.20.
